About
The School

Lakeside Academy, founded in 2001 through the merger of Bishop Whelan and Lachine High School, serves a culturally diverse community. Embracing the International Baccalaureate (IB) philosophy, the school promotes critical thinking and global awareness in all programs. Lakeside continuously innovates, integrating Robotics and Indigenous cultural exploration into its curriculum. With a strong focus on respect, responsibility, and student success, Lakeside Academy nurtures individuals who take pride in their education and future.

Programs

Lakeside Academy offers a range of academic programs to suit diverse student needs:



  • International Baccalaureate (IB) Middle Years Programme (MYP): A school-wide program fostering global perspectives and critical thinking.

  • IB Enriched Program: Advanced Ministry subjects with enriched French and Spanish for Secondary I to III students.

  • IB English Program: All courses in English, with French taught at the base level.

  • Media Communication Arts Program: Focuses on graphic arts, web design, print/audio production, and video production.

  • Drama Program: Available for senior students, promoting self-expression and collaboration through acting and voice techniques.

  • Physical Education Program: Encourages fitness, communication, and lifelong physical activity.
